 Traveling from Rawalpindi to Gujrat offers several transportation options, each with its unique route, distance, and travel duration. Here's an extensive guide outlining various ways to make this journey:

  1. Road Trip via Car or Taxi:

    • Distance: Approximately 200 kilometers
    • Route: From Rawalpindi, take the Islamabad-Lahore Motorway (M2). Drive through the motorway and take the Gujrat Interchange.
    • Travel Duration: Around 2.5 to 3 hours depending on traffic and speed.
  2. Bus Travel:

    • Distance: Similar to the road trip via car or taxi.
    • Route: Multiple bus services operate between Rawalpindi and Gujrat. These buses typically follow the same route as private vehicles using the Islamabad-Lahore Motorway (M2) and stopping at Gujrat.
    • Travel Duration: Around 3 to 4 hours depending on the number of stops and traffic.
  3. Train Journey:

    • Distance: Approximately 150 kilometers via railway tracks.
    • Route: Rawalpindi is well-connected to Gujrat by train services. Trains often take the Rawalpindi-Lala Musa-Gujrat route.
    • Travel Duration: Depending on the train service and stops, the journey can take between 3 to 4 hours.
